The 7045 is essentially a voltage measuring device. Where necessary,
multimeter inputs must be converted into a dc voltage level and suitably
scaled prior to analogue to digital conversion. This process is carried out in
the Signal Conditioning Section.
The Analogue to Digital (A-to-D) Converter produces two balanced pulse
trains at its output. Any measured input causes the pulse width of one of the
trains to increase, with a proportionate decrease in the width of the other; the
nett result is processed in the Digital Section of the multimeter.
This section includes a clock circuit. Pulses from the A-to-D Converter provide
a clock-enable to a synchronous Counter, thus a count is produced
proportional to the measured input. The Digital Section also exercises control
over the analogue circuitry with regard to range decision and control of the
measurement function.
Power supplies for the multimeter are derived from a mains operated
transformer with provision made for either 230 volts or 115 volt operation. A
Battery Unit, when fitted with optional cells, provides an alternative power
source.
